Writing Camp - Sharpen your Quill!
Grades K-6. Be a "professional" writer and illustrator while expanding your critical thinking skills. Writers create a publishing company, plan and produce individual, fully illustrated unique picture books. Discussions include writing motivation, craft of writing, extensive literature exposure, anti-bias and multi-cultural themes. Art exploration includes graphic design, watercolor, illustration and collage techniques. In just one short week, transform your first drafts into personal masterpieces. Students provide lunch, beverage and snacks. Director: Eileen Bigham. 1 week. April 5 - 9.

Baseball Camp - Spring Training
Can’t wait for Baseball season? Get an early start to your game by joining camp. Whether you have played for a few seasons or just starting out, this camp is for you! Each day you'll work on basic to advanced baseball skills and play a game. You will learn in a safe, structured environment, while having fun and gaining confidence in your sport. Daily hitting, fielding, pitching and outfield stations are featured as well as trivia contests and prizes for everyone! Each camper receives a written camp evaluation. Campers should bring mitts, bats and water bottles marked with their name. Director: GVP Sports staff.
